Ciliary peristalsis flow of hydromagnetic Sutterby nanofluid through symmetric channel: Viscous dissipation in case of variable electrical conductivity
For the sperm to have the best chance of reaching the egg, the ciliated walls of the uterine tube must be meticulously monitored. Recognizing the significance of this investigation, a novel mathematical simulation of this process has been performed by analyzing the dynamics of a non-Newtonian magnet...
